Actuarial Justification for AI Rating Variables
Actuarial justification for AI rating variables means demonstrating, with documented evidence, that a variable derived from a machine-learning model has a logical and actuarially sound relationship to risk of loss, not merely a statistical correlation, and that the model producing it is governed by an accountable, auditable oversight process.
What Actuarial Justification Requires
The baseline legal standard applied by state regulators, drawn from the NAIC Unfair Trade Practices Act model law, is that insurance rates must not be excessive, inadequate, or unfairly discriminatory. When a rating variable originates from an AI or machine-learning process, regulators apply this standard through an additional lens: does the variable have a demonstrable relationship to risk of loss, and can the insurer produce documentation showing how that relationship was established and is being maintained.
The NAIC's Regulatory Review of Predictive Models framework directs reviewers to look past model output and ask whether a variable has a logical, actuarially sound connection to loss experience, rather than accepting a statistical correlation identified by the model as sufficient on its own. This shifts the burden onto actuarial and compliance teams to produce a rationale that goes beyond model performance metrics.
The Current Regulatory Framework
The NAIC Model Bulletin on the Use of Artificial Intelligence Systems by Insurers, adopted and issued by multiple states, requires insurers to maintain a documented AI governance program and risk management framework, and to maintain an inventory of AI systems in use, including those affecting rating, with documented purpose, inputs, and oversight mechanisms for each system.
Colorado's Division of Insurance, acting under authority granted by SB21-169, has gone further for life insurers by requiring quantitative testing of external consumer data and algorithms for unfair discrimination tied to protected classes, and by requiring insurers to maintain documentation of testing methodology, results, and remediation steps that must be made available to the Division upon request.
NCOIL has advanced a model act that parallels the NAIC bulletin's governance and accountability concepts, reinforcing that this is a converging multistate expectation rather than an isolated requirement in one jurisdiction.

Correlation Versus Actuarial Support
Regulators distinguish between two categories of rating variables produced by AI models. The first has an identifiable, plausible risk-based mechanism, similar to variables long accepted in traditional generalized linear models. The second is identified purely through machine-learning feature importance or predictive lift, without an accompanying explanation of why the variable should relate to loss.
Variables in the second category are treated by regulators as higher risk for challenge. The model type matters here: gradient boosting and other less interpretable techniques increase the burden of justification compared to a GLM, because the mechanism connecting the variable to loss is harder to articulate from the model itself. Insurers should expect to pair statistical validation, such as loss ratio relationships and predictive lift, with a written narrative rationale explaining a plausible causal or risk-based mechanism for each variable, not just its statistical performance.
Sustaining Justification After Approval
Regulatory guidance treats actuarial justification as an ongoing obligation rather than a one-time deliverable. Insurers are expected to conduct periodic re-validation and update documentation when models are retrained or when the composition of rating variables changes. Ongoing monitoring should track model drift, changes in variable importance, and outcome disparities that could undermine the original justification provided at approval.
Governance frameworks should include escalation procedures for situations where monitoring detects disparate impact or a weakening correlation between a rating variable and actual loss experience. Because Colorado's prescriptive testing regime differs from the more general unfairly discriminatory standard applied in other states, multistate insurers need a governance approach designed to meet the most stringent applicable requirement rather than the lowest common denominator.

Documentation Elements Regulators Expect
A defensible package typically includes inventory, lineage, testing, and oversight artifacts that reviewers can request on short notice.
- A centralized AI or model inventory documenting purpose, inputs, and rating variables tied to each model
- Variable definitions, data lineage, and training and validation data splits
- Performance metrics broken out by demographic subgroup where feasible
- Disparate impact or proxy discrimination testing linking rating variables to protected class membership
- Testing methodology, results, and remediation steps retained and available on request
- Documented board and senior management oversight accountability for AI systems affecting policyholders
Frequently Asked Questions
Does actuarial justification apply only to newly introduced rating variables?
No. Regulatory guidance treats justification as an ongoing obligation. When a model is retrained or a rating variable's composition changes, insurers are expected to re-validate and update the justification documentation, not rely on the original approval indefinitely.
How does documentation burden differ between GLM and machine-learning models?
Interpretability affects the burden of proof. GLM variables often have a more directly explainable structure, while machine-learning-derived variables, such as those from gradient boosting, typically require a supplemental narrative rationale connecting the variable to risk of loss.
Is Colorado's testing regulation relevant to insurers outside Colorado?
Colorado's algorithm and predictive model testing requirements are specific to that state's authority under SB21-169, but given multistate regulatory alignment trends, they are commonly referenced as a practical benchmark for documentation rigor even by insurers not directly subject to them.
